The Crescent, Homebush NSW 2140 is a collector road with a 40km/h limit. 14 homes sit above the street; 16 homes sit level with the street. 5 homes are heritage-listed, 8 have a flood overlay, and 11 are recommended for a flood check. 22 homes have other flood classifications. The street is 18.6% houses and 60.5% apartments. There are insufficient recent house sales to calculate a reliable comparison against the suburb.

What are the risk and overlay factors on The Crescent?

There are 5 heritage-listed properties, meaning renovations or exterior changes may require additional council approval. Eight properties fall within a flood overlay, 11 are recommended for a flood check, and 22 have been reviewed with no flood risk identified or not mapped. There are no bushfire or high-voltage powerline overlays on the street.

Are properties on The Crescent mostly on high, level or low ground?

14 homes sit above the street; 16 homes sit level with the street. Different site heights relative to the street can influence site characteristics, so buyers should assess the specific property rather than relying on the street average.

What type of road is The Crescent?

The Crescent is a collector road with a 40 km/h speed limit, and 57.7% of the residential stock fronts this dominant section. Collector roads generally connect local streets with larger roads, which may result in slightly more through traffic than a local residential street.

Is The Crescent mostly houses or apartments?

The Crescent has 220 residential properties, with 60.5% being apartments and 18.6% being houses. This indicates the street is predominantly apartments rather than houses.

What are the major apartment developments on The Crescent?

The major apartment developments on The Crescent include 6 The Crescent with 26 lots across 4 levels built in 2008, 9 The Crescent with 17 lots across 4 levels built in 2007, and 35 The Crescent with 12 lots across 3 levels. These developments contribute to the street's higher-density residential character.

How many properties have sold on The Crescent?

One house and three apartments have sold in the past 12 months. The 5-year turnover rate is 9.8% for houses and 19.5% for apartments, representing the proportion of properties that changed ownership during the past five years.
